1972 Bristol 411 vs. 2004 Fiat Ulysse

To start off, 2004 Fiat Ulysse is newer by 32 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1972 Bristol 411.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1972 Bristol 411 would be higher. At 6,276 cc (8 cylinders), 1972 Bristol 411 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1972 Bristol 411 (288 HP @ 5200 RPM) has 162 more horse power than 2004 Fiat Ulysse. (126 HP @ 4000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1972 Bristol 411 should accelerate faster than 2004 Fiat Ulysse.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2004 Fiat Ulysse weights approximately 73 kg more than 1972 Bristol 411.

Let's talk about torque, 1972 Bristol 411 (588 Nm @ 3400 RPM) has 274 more torque (in Nm) than 2004 Fiat Ulysse. (314 Nm @ 2000 RPM). This means 1972 Bristol 411 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2004 Fiat Ulysse.
